Abstract

Background: Pott’s fracture is considered the most frequent type of ankle fractures and constitutes the most common complaint in the emergency department. Aim: to assess patients’ knowledge and functional outcome regarding Pott’s fracture at Aswan University Hospital. Subjects and method: This study utilized a descriptive research design. Setting: This study was executed at Aswan University Hospital's orthopedic department and outpatient clinics. Subjects: A purposive sample of 80 patients who fulfilled specific inclusion criteria. Tools: Tool I: Patients’ health assessment questionnaire sheet. Tool II: Patients’ knowledge questionnaire sheet. Tool III: Baird and Jackson Scoring System (BJSS) to assess physical activity and functional ability. Results: demonstrate that more than three-quarters of the participants had unsatisfactory total knowledge score regarding Pott’s fractures. Furthermore, about ninety-one point three of the participants had poor functional outcome by using Baird and Jackson scoring scale. Conclusion: Study’s findings highlighted that decreased knowledge about Pott’s fracture patients lead to physical inactivity, functional disability and other complications. Recommendation: Educational guidelines should be encouraged and suggested to all patients with Pott’s fracture in order to increase patients' education and functional outcomes.
